The cheapest way to get from Scarborough to Elora is to drive which costs $23 - $35 and takes 1h 36m.
The fastest way to get from Scarborough to Elora is to drive which takes 1h 36m and costs $23 - $35.
No, there is no direct bus from Scarborough station to Elora. However, there are services departing from Scarborough Centre Station at Bus Bay 12 and arriving at Town of Elora, ON via Toronto - 34 Asquith Avenue.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 27m.
The distance between Scarborough and Elora is 127 km. The road distance is 119.1 km.
The best way to get from Scarborough to Elora without a car is to line 2 subway and bus which takes 2h 57m and costs $65 - $85.
It takes approximately 2h 57m to get from Scarborough to Elora, including transfers.
Scarborough to Elora bus services, operated by Parkbus, depart from Toronto - 34 Asquith Avenue station.
Scarborough to Elora bus services, operated by Parkbus, arrive at Town of Elora, ON station.
Yes, the driving distance between Scarborough to Elora is 119 km. It takes approximately 1h 36m to drive from Scarborough to Elora.
